Cognex (NASDAQ:CGNX) Price Target Lowered to $29.00 at Truist Financial

Cognex (NASDAQ:CGNXFree Report) had its price target reduced by Truist Financial from $37.00 to $29.00 in a report released on Tuesday,Benzinga reports. They currently have a hold rating on the scientific and technical instruments company’s stock.

Several other research firms also recently weighed in on CGNX. The Goldman Sachs Group lowered their target price on Cognex from $39.00 to $35.00 and set a “sell” rating on the stock in a research report on Tuesday, February 18th. HSBC cut Cognex from a “buy” rating to a “hold” rating and set a $33.00 price objective on the stock. in a research report on Friday, February 21st. UBS Group reduced their target price on shares of Cognex from $58.00 to $56.00 and set a “buy” rating for the company in a report on Tuesday, February 18th. Needham & Company LLC dropped their price target on shares of Cognex from $47.00 to $41.00 and set a “buy” rating for the company in a research report on Friday, February 14th. Finally, Hsbc Global Res cut shares of Cognex from a “strong-bu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a research note on Friday, February 21st. One research anal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, seven have given a hold rating, five have given a buy rating and one has assigned a strong buy rating to the company.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the company presently has an average rating of “Hold” and a consensus price target of $44.17.

About Cognex

Cognex Corporation provides machine vision products that capture and analyze visual information to automate manufacturing and distribution tasks worldwide. Its machine vision products are used to automate the manufacturing and tracking of discrete items, including mobile phones, electric vehicle batteries, and e-commerce packages by locating, identifying, inspecting, and measuring them during the manufacturing or distribution process.
